Democratic Party presidential candidate Lee Jae-myung visits Gwangju today (28th) and continues the work of living in Honam for the third day. People's Power Presidential Candidate Seok-Yeol Yoon focuses on a schedule aimed at the 2030 generation, such as attending the inauguration ceremony of the Youth Committee.

Democratic Party candidate Lee Jae-myung, who is on a tour of Honam for 4 days and 3 nights, will attend the inauguration ceremony of the Gwangju Great Transition Election Committee held at the Kimdaejung Convention Center on the third day.



Candidate Lee put the young generation at the forefront by filling most of the election committee chairpersons with 2030 generations as the first regional election committee inauguration ceremony.



Previously, Candidate Lee visited the Mayor of Songjeong in Gwangju on the 5th and had time to communicate with local residents, and plans to meet residents of Bitgaram Innovation City in Naju, Jeollanam-do to inform his plan for balanced regional development.

People's Strength Candidate Yoon Seok-yeol is taking steps to target young people every day, less than 100 days before the presidential election.



Candidate Yoon will attend the inauguration ceremony of the Youth Committee in Yeouido, Seoul this afternoon.



After watching the art exhibition of young artists at the Seoul Arts Center yesterday, candidate Yoon plans to focus on youth-related schedules all weekend, targeting the votes of the 2030 generation, which is considered the 'casting boat' of this election.



Kim Byung-joon, chairman of the People's Power Standing Election Committee, held a press conference today and criticized candidate Lee Jae-myung, who spoke of murder as dating violence, as not qualified as a political leader.
